Corrugated Iron Sheets: Strength & LongevityCorrugated Steel Roofing: Durability & LifespanWavy Metal Panels: Resilience & Endurance
When it comes to budget-friendly and robust building materials, corrugated iron sheets consistently show their worth. These panels of coated iron are renowned for their exceptional strength, capable of enduring harsh weather conditions, from torrential rain. Their unique profile isn't just aesthetically pleasing; it provides inherent structural integrity, preventing deformation under load. Furthermore, with proper installation and care, corrugated iron sheets offer an impressively long lifespan, frequently exceeding several decades. This combination of resilience and longevity makes them a favorable choice for a wide range of uses, including agricultural buildings and home shelters. Choosing quality materials and adhering to best practices further confirms their long-term performance.
Ceiling Sheets: Materials, Styles & Applications
Selecting suitable covering sheets for your project involves a assessment of several aspects. Numerous materials are available, each offering different characteristics and benefits. Corrugated metal sheets, often made from galvanized steel or aluminum, are popular for their robustness and cost-effectiveness. Fiberglass sheets present a lighter-weight alternative, known for their resistance to corrosion and excellent insulating qualities. Bituminous sheets, typically used in flat roofs, provide waterproofing and long-term protection. Regarding styles, options range from classic corrugation to profiled designs that enhance aesthetic appeal. Applications are equally diverse - agricultural buildings, residential homes, commercial structures, and even temporary shelters can all utilize these versatile roofing solutions. Ultimately, the best choice depends on your specific requirements, budget, and desired look.
